An American ABC drama that follows a special agent (James Denton) leading an elite team to track down terrorists as part of Homeland Security.

The show also stars Kelly Rutherford, Will Lyman, Anthony Azizi, Kurt Caceres, Mahershala Ali, Melora Walters, and Shoshannah Stern.

It aired from September 18, 2003 to January 29, 2004.

  • Secret Message Wink: An episode has the NSA coax a captured Soviet spy into revealing his contact, promising he'll be traded for Americans held captive in the Soviet Union. The man is given papers to sign agreeing to this, which he's told is basic boilerplate legalese. However, at the rendezvous as the clock strikes 11:00, the man removes his hat, which an alert agent recognizes as an "abort" signal. The Soviet agent knows his contact will not get the same deal, because she is an American citizen, guilty of high treason.
  • Shout-Out: The final episode aired on ABC was titled "Extremist Makeover", in reference to the reality show Extreme Makeover. The plot involves a group of terrorists undergoing the kind of extensive plastic surgery depicted on the show as part of a plot to infiltrate a target undetected, and the Homeland Security team's efforts to uncover their new faces before they could strike said target.
